Animal Welfare Labeling and Consumer Choice

Animal welfare labeling systems vary enormously in standards and enforcement, making it difficult for consumers to make informed choices.

Key Facts

Welfare Considerations

Current welfare labeling systems often fail consumers and animals alike. Terms like free-range have minimal legal definition and hide significant variation in actual welfare outcomes. Inadequate audit frequency allows certification of facilities with ongoing welfare problems. Without credible, standardized labeling, consumer demand for higher welfare cannot effectively incentivize industry improvement.
